[Bug 561239] [NEW] Evolution through localhost proxy doesn't work
Public bug reported: Binary package hint: evolution At work, Internet is accessed through NTLM-authenticated proxy. Therefore, I run ntlmaps proxy and configure it in evolution. It works fine if ntlmaps proxy is run on another host (e.g. my-other- computer:5865) but doesn't work if it is run on localhost:5865. Firefox and other applications have no problem using proxy at localhost:5865. I haven't tested which parts of evolution are affected but at least google calender cannot be read through proxy on localhost:5865. ** Affects: evolution (Ubuntu) Importance: Undecided Status: New ** Tags: calendar evolution proxy -- Evolution through localhost proxy doesn't work https://bugs.launchpad.net/bugs/561239 You received this bug notification because you are a member of Ubuntu Bugs, which is subscribed to Ubuntu. -- ubuntu-bugs mailing list ubuntu-bugs@lists.ubuntu.com https://lists.ubuntu.com/mailman/listinfo/ubuntu-bugs

[Bug 116178] ntlmaps process should be started with hihger niceness
Public bug reported: Binary package hint: ntlmaps Currently ntlmaps runs with niceness of 0. For any reason the process consumes a lot of CPU when http connection is active over the proxy. So much CPU that GUI responsiveness degrades dramatically if 3 or more pages are being loaded simultaneously in Firefox. The solution is to renice ntlmaps process. http connection performance doesn't degrade and this fixes computer responsiveness. I usually add -N 19 to the /etc/init.d/ntlmaps startup script so startup section looks as following: start) echo -n Starting $DESC: start-stop-daemon --start -N 19 --quiet --pidfile /var/run/$NAME.pid \ --background --exec $DAEMON -- $DAEMON_OPTS echo $NAME. ;; ** Affects: ntlmaps (Ubuntu) Importance: Undecided Status: Unconfirmed -- ntlmaps process should be started with hihger niceness https://bugs.launchpad.net/bugs/116178 You received this bug notification because you are a member of Ubuntu Bugs, which is the bug contact for Ubuntu. -- ubuntu-bugs mailing list ubuntu-bugs@lists.ubuntu.com https://lists.ubuntu.com/mailman/listinfo/ubuntu-bugs
